  2. No limit that I know of. Had more then 15 dirnks a few day last year on the crown princess

     

    Remember. This is not all alcohol drinks. It includes all the fancy coffees. Brewed coffee, sodas, bottled water, and a lot more. I don't think people add up every cent of everything they drink every day. Any kind of drink. Alcohol or non- alcohol.
